Warm Chicken Sweet Potato Hash
A grounding dinner skillet with tender chicken, sweet potato, and fresh kale. Easy to prep in batch for five generous servings.

Equipment
Large skillet · Knife and cutting board
Time saver
Using pre-cooked leftover roasted chicken cuts down active cooking time dramatically.

Heat extra-virgin ol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at at 350°F (175°C) for 2 minutes until shimmering.

Add diced yellow onion and minced garlic clove to the skillet and cook for 3 to 4 minutes until translucent and aromatic.

Stir in cubed sweet potato, cover the skillet, and cook for 10 to 12 minutes, stirring occasionally, until sweet potato pieces are tender when pierced with a fork.

Fold in shredded cooked chicken breast and chopped kale, cooking for another 3 to 4 minutes until the chicken is thoroughly warmed through and kale is wilted.

Divide into 5 equal portions and serve immediately, or cool completely before storing leftovers in airtight containers for up to 4 days in the refrigerator.
